The most effective physical exercises for managing kyphosis are stretching exercises that target the chest and shoulder muscles, as well as strengthening exercises for the back muscles. These exercises help improve posture and reduce the curvature of the upper spine associated with kyphosis. Examples include chest stretches, shoulder blade squeezes, and back extensions. It is important to consult with a healthcare professional or physical therapist before starting any exercise program for kyphosis.
